Understanding the Fiat 500 Key Technology
Before talking about expenses, it is important to understand what makes a Fiat Tipo Replacement Key 500 crucial more than just a piece of metal. Because the relaunch of the design in 2007, Fiat has used "Transponder Technology" throughout its fleet.
Each secret contains a little transponder chip embedded in the plastic head or fob. When the key is placed into the ignition (or brought inside the cabin in newer proximity models), the car's Engine Control Unit (ECU) sends out a signal to the key. If the digital code from the crucial matches the code programmed into the car's immobilizer system, the engine begins. If they do not match, the car remains stationary. This security procedure is extremely reliable against hot-wiring but makes complex the replacement procedure.

Several variables can cause the rate of a replacement secret to change substantially. Understanding these elements can assist owners spending plan accordingly.
1. The Model Year and Trim
Older Fiat 500 models typically use simpler innovation. The intro of more innovative encryption in later models (specifically those produced after 2016) typically requires more expensive diagnostic equipment to program, increasing labor expenses.
2. Place and Time of Service
Labor rates for automobile locksmith professionals and dealerships vary by area. In addition, if a driver needs an emergency situation mobile locksmith professional at 2:00 AM on a weekend, "call-out charges" can add ₤ 100 or more to the last expense.
3. All Keys Lost vs. Spare Key Duplication
It is substantially less expensive to duplicate an existing key than to develop one from scratch when all keys are lost. If the "master" secret is missing, a service technician should extract the security code from the automobile's computer or order the code from Fiat's database, which adds to the cost.
4. The Source of the Replacement
Where the owner chooses to get the key-- a dealership, an independent locksmith professional, or an online retailer-- is the most significant factor of the final rate.

Independent Automotive Locksmiths
For the majority of Fiat 500 Key Replacement Cost owners, a specialized automotive locksmith professional is the most efficient option. Numerous locksmith professionals bring mobile shows kits and can cut "laser-cut" blades on-site. They can generally gain entry to a locked car and program a brand-new key within an hour. This removes towing fees and long wait times.
Online Purchases
It is possible to purchase "blank" Fiat keys on sites like eBay or Amazon for a fraction of the expense. However, this is a "purchaser beware" situation. Fiat Car Key Replacement keys must have the appropriate frequency (typically 433MHz or 315MHz depending upon the market) and a virgin (opened) transponder chip. Lots of online keys are utilized shells with "locked" chips that can not be reprogrammed. Even with a legitimate online key, the owner should still pay a professional to cut and program it.

Q: Can I set a Fiat 500 essential myself?A: No. Unlike some older Ford or GM automobiles that enable "on-board shows," the Fiat 500 needs specialized diagnostic software to access the BCM (Body Control Module) to license new keys.
Q: Does car insurance cover key replacement?A: It depends on the policy. Some comprehensive insurance policies or "Auto Club" subscriptions (like AAA) use key replacement protection or a stipend for locksmith services. It is worth inspecting the policy details.
Q: My essential turns in the ignition but the car will not begin. What's incorrect?A: If a "Key Symbol" or "Security Light" appears on the dashboard, the car does not acknowledge the transponder chip. This could indicate the chip is harmed or the antenna ring around the ignition barrel has failed.
Q: How long does the replacement process take?A: A mobile locksmith professional can normally complete the task in 30 to 60 minutes once they arrive at the automobile. A dealership might take several days if they require to order the crucial blank.
